Margo | 2 comments I became hooked on cozy mysteries after reading my first Agatha Christie many, many years ago. I read every one of her books and then went on to discover so many more authors who wrote in the same genre. Some of my favorites are M.C. Beaton, Mary Kay Andrews, Nancy Atherton, Mignon Ballard, Dorothy Cannell, Diane Mott Daviidson, Sharon Fiffer, Earlene Fowler, Joan Hess, Rosemary Harris, Toni, Kelner, Katherine Hall Page, Ann Purser, and the list could go on and on. Once I find an author I like I'll go do no length to read all of their books.

Louie Flann (LouieFlann) | 1 comments Am I the only guy in this group?

I enjoy stories by M.C.Beaton, Rita Mae Brown, Rhys Bowen, Alexander McCall Smith and my favorite author for cozies is Alan Bradley. His heroine, Flavia de Luce, is a young girl with a passion for chemistry and solving crimes. I think he is a must read.
